jMedtech is a supplier of upstream materials and coating solutions for medical devices, founded in Singapore in 2013. The company integrates functional coating R&D, precision medical tubing extrusion, and contract development and manufacturing (CDMO). Over the past 13 years, the Group has grown into an international enterprise with 4 production and R&D bases, 5 marketing centers, over 300 employees, and more than 600 global customers. Its cardiovascular catheter components have cumulatively shipped over 60 million units, with products exported to 30+ countries and regions across Asia, Europe, and the Americas. A: jMedtech was founded in Singapore in 2013.
From its inception, the team anchored itself in the niche sector of medical materials.
Key development milestones:
Year | Milestone |
2013 | Founded in Singapore, positioned as an upstream medical device materials company |
2014 | Established a production base in Xiamen, China; signed a strategic cooperation agreement with A*STAR |
2015 | Obtained ISO 13485 quality management system certification |
2017 | Achieved large-scale production of hydrophilic coating technology; completed US FDA registration |
2019 | Established an in-house equipment R&D team; achieved independent development of coating support equipment |
2020 | Core technology granted Chinese invention patent; completed PCT/US/EU/JP global patent portfolio |
2021 | Expanded into the precision PTFE tubing sector |
2022 | Established subsidiary Jiemeijiacheng; added 4,500 m² Haicang facility; established Shanghai branch |
2023 | Ranked among the top 10 global medical hydrophilic coating companies |
2025 | Strategically acquired controlling stake in US-based Hydromer, upgrading global footprint |

A: Very extensive. jMedtech's production experience can be assessed from several dimensions:
Production Line Scale and Capacity
Production Metric | Data |
Total production base area | 30,000+ m² |
PTFE liner tubing production lines | 15 lines, monthly capacity of 1 million units |
Process Depth
• Three parallel tubing process routes: mandrel-based extrusion (OTW), free extrusion, and dip coating, covering all scenarios from standard to ultra-small specifications
• Extreme manufacturing capabilities: Mini tubing inner diameter down to 0.10 mm; PTFE heat shrink tubing wall thickness as low as 0.01 mm; dip-coated wall thickness down to 0.00025 inch
• Self-developed equipment: core equipment including automated coating lines, friction testers, and push-force testers are all developed in-house, independent of external equipment suppliers
• Flexible delivery: standard products in 2 weeks; regular customization in 4–8 weeks; microcatheter rapid prototyping in 7 days with no minimum order quantity

Global Footprint Structure
Region | Location | Function |
Singapore | R&D Headquarters (JTC Medtech Hub) | Headquarters, R&D center, Southeast Asia market coverage |
Xiamen, China | Xiang'an Plant + Haicang Plant | Primary production base; coating and tubing mass production |
Shanghai, China | Branch Office | Coating prototyping, product showroom, sales and technical support |
North Carolina, USA | Hydromer Subsidiary | Thermal-cure coatings, Americas market service, FDA regulatory support |
Global | 5 Marketing Centers | Covering markets across Asia, Europe, and the Americas |
